Ecommerce development pricing varies significantly based on your project's complexity, required features, integrations, and timeline. A basic online store will differ from an enterprise platform with custom functionalities, advanced payment systems, and third-party integrations. Development timelines for Houston ecommerce projects typically range from 8-16 weeks depending on complexity and feature requirements. A standard online store with product catalogs and payment processing can launch in 8-10 weeks, while custom platforms with advanced inventory management, multi-vendor capabilities, or B2B functionalities may require 12-16 weeks. Houston's fast-paced business environment drives many clients toward phased launches, where we deploy a core platform first, then add advanced features in subsequent releases to accelerate time-to-market.

Platform selection depends on your business model, growth trajectory, and technical requirements rather than size alone. Shopify and WooCommerce work well for businesses seeking quick deployment with standard features, while Magento and custom solutions suit companies needing extensive customization, complex B2B workflows, or unique integrations. Houston businesses with existing enterprise systems often benefit from headless commerce architectures that separate frontend experiences from backend operations. We build ecommerce platforms with scalable architecture, optimized databases, and CDN integration to handle traffic spikes during promotions or seasonal peaks. Performance optimization includes image compression, lazy loading, efficient caching strategies, and streamlined checkout processes that reduce cart abandonment. For Houston businesses targeting both local and international markets, we implement geo-targeted content delivery and ensure fast loading times across regions. Security measures include SSL certificates, PCI compliance for payment processing, and regular security audits to protect customer data and maintain trust.

We connect ecommerce platforms with inventory management systems, accounting software like QuickBooks, CRM platforms, shipping providers, and warehouse management systems. Many Houston industrial and B2B companies require real-time synchronization between their ecommerce storefront and backend ERP systems to manage complex pricing, inventory across multiple locations, and customer-specific catalogs. We also integrate with marketing automation tools, analytics platforms, and customer support systems to create unified operational ecosystems.
